BookXchanger is a website where a person can buy or sell his books. Every year we see that if a student wants to buy second-hand books he has to ask everyone whether they have books or not. Similarly, if a person wants to sell his old books he has to ask everyone and search for buyers. So we try to create a platform where a person can buy or sell his second-hand books without any difficulty. So we try to make a BookXchanger website with almost all the features which can resolve all the problems the buyers or sellers face while buying or selling a book.
